In order to seek finality, Egypt is building a trench two kilometers from the Gaza border, twenty meters wide, ten deep. This will force very difficult engineering pressures on ISIS to respond. Their tunnels will either have to slope two miles, resulting in water table issues and flood risks, or use stairs (with its own flood and hydrolic issues), as well as breathing issues, as its unlikely they can pop breathing pipes to the surface, and compressing air through pipes produce tell tail electric and vibrational signatures, not to mention rather obvious machinery buildup at the Gaza end of the tunnel.

It already has a border fence with Thailand… funny thing, Thailand and Malaysia BOTH built a border fence along their respective borders, to stop smugglers and leftist guerilla groups… leaving a 10 meter gap between them, which became the new preferred smuggler route! Malaysia and Thailand have agreed since to have only one wall along that border in Thailand’s territory.
